For their scrappy, sharp record-release gig at London's Rough Trade East on August 20, Manchester's Westside Cowboy galloped through the whole of their debut album, It Goes On, track by track. They've bounced to the other side of that chaotic and happy week with rave reviews and It Goes On debuting at No. 5 on the UK album charts.
